Tips for Newcomers in Taylor
If you're attending an NA meeting in Taylor, Nebraska for the first time, here are some helpful suggestions:
- Recovery is not a competition—your journey is uniquely yours.
- Meetings are free—never feel obligated to contribute money, especially as a newcomer.
- Ask for a newcomer packet—most meetings have literature specifically for first-timers.
- The "90 meetings in 90 days" suggestion is common advice for newcomers.
- Focus on similarities, not differences, when listening to others share.
- If one meeting doesn't feel right, try a different group or format.

Am I welcome at Taylor, Nebraska meetings if I take prescribed medication?
NA has no opinion on outside issues, including medication. Members who take medication prescribed by a doctor are welcome at meetings in Taylor, Nebraska. NA defines "clean" as abstinence from all drugs, which individual members interpret for themselves.

Are NA meetings in Taylor, Nebraska free?
NA meetings in Taylor, Nebraska are free to attend. Meetings are self-supporting through voluntary contributions from members, but no one is expected to donate, especially newcomers. NA receives no outside funding.
